  2. Brown Paper Essays 1 - 5 - 1974.02.1181

    Transcript of John F. Hobbs's five Brown Paper Essays. Known for his oratorical skill, John Hobbs was much in demand as a speaker at local gatherings, and often wrote out pencil drafts of his speeches on butcher paper in the Village Store (hence their common designation "Brown Paper Essays"). Located in the file category "Manuscripts". The originals are in the map cabinet.
